Plot Summary of Sweet Revenge
"In this wonderful tale of love and revenge we meet our main character Adrianne, who has a deep secret, which she has shared only with one person, her friend Celeste. As the time draws near for Adrianne to return to her home to take revenge on her father for the things he did to her mother she meets a man. Phillip Chamberlain, who unearths her every secret. Will she pull her off her final plans for revenge before Phillip interfere's not only with her plans but with her heart."

"From the moment Phillip Chamberlain saw gorgeous, chic, twenty-five year old Princess Adrianne, he knows she is the one behind all the robberies going on. The question is, why? She certainly doesn't need the money. Adrianne only knows one thing: revenge. Revenge for the fairytale that really wasn't a fairytale that her movie-star mother had to endure while married to her father, the king. Beatings and sexual molestations were what her mother had to live with when she married the king that believed women were of little value with the exception of producing heirs and giving pleasure to men. Adrianne and her mother finally escaped, but in the years to follow her mother dies, and so a livid Adrianne sets out to take back into her possession what was originally her mothers: The Sun and Moon necklace. Phillip struggles with the dilemma of what to do. He could either do his job and accuse the criminal of her crimes, or he could help the women he loves in getting her revenge…"
